StoneX reiterates Buy rating on Canaan stock at $1 target

StoneX maintained a Buy rating on Canaan Inc. (NASDAQ:CAN) with a $1.00 price target, citing its efficient A16 mining rig and strategic shift to power platform expansion. The stock is down 62% over the past year, trading at $0.31. Canaan's Q2 2026 revenue of $32 million missed estimates due to weak demand for bitcoin mining machines and volatile cryptocurrency prices.

Canaan (CAN) Q2 2026 Earnings Call Transcript

Canaan (CAN) reported Q2 2026 revenue of $31.9M, down from $100.2M YoY, due to lower computing power sales and decreased average selling prices. Mining revenue was $17.7M, impacted by bitcoin price pressure. The company reported a gross loss of $29.3M and a net loss of $97.6M, including inventory write-downs. Bitcoin production was 243 bitcoins, and the digital asset treasury reached a record $112M. Management guided Q3 revenue to be $11M-$15M, citing market demand and inventory levels.

Canaan Q2 Earnings Call Highlights

Canaan reported Q2 cash balance of $66M, up from $43M. Project ABC generated $5.2M in cash, but $4M in equity losses. Company repurchased 16.4M ADSs for $7.4M. Q3 revenue forecasted at $11M-$15M. Canaan holds 1,861 Bitcoin post-sale. Nasdaq granted compliance extension to Jan 2027.
